Score Card
Each course will have its own score card with the following
  • ‘Yards’ for the length of each hole (women's normally in red)
  • 'Par' the number of shots to complete the hole in Par (3,4,or 5)
  • 'Index' relates to the difficulty of each hole with 1 being the hardest and 18 the easiest.

H
andicap
A guide to the standard of your golf game and allows golfers of different playing abilities to play against each other on somewhat equal terms.

A golf professional would be expected have a handicap of '0' or Scratch scoring Pars of 3,4 & 5

The maximum handicap for women is 36 which gives two extra shots per hole

Par     Extra shots    
3        +2        = 5
4        +2        = 6
5        +2        = 7

What is a official Golf Handicap? 
The only way to get an ‘official’ golf handicap is to join a Golf Club affiliated to CONGU.

Why would you want a Golf Handicap? 
      To continually measure your own standard of golf game.
      To use as a fair and reasonable measurement when playing against other golfers.
      To enter competitions or to play on certain golf courses that request a certificate.

Competitions
Player swap cards at the beginning of the game, placing their own golf scores in the 'markers' column and the players scores for whom they are marking in the associated columns.

There are many different ways a competition can be played however they are normally based on either Medal or Match play.

Medal /Stroke Play – players record the total number of golf shots taken in the entire round.  The players handicap is then deducted to give a net score. The lowest net score wins.

Match Play -   players record their score on each hole competing hole by hole. The player who taking fewer shots on the hole compared to their opponent wins the hole. 

Stableford Competition – one of the most common ways to score is based on points awarded for each hole to an individual player according to their handicap the winner is the one who scores the most points over 18 holes therefore ignoring any holes with no score. A team score is normally based on the best two players scores in the team for each hole.

Scoring points as follows

 Shots  Points  Name
 +3  0  Triple Bogey
 +2  0  Double Bogey
 +1  1  Bogey
 Par  2  Par
 -1  3  Birdie
 -2  4  Eagle
 -3  5  Albatross

Texas Scramble
A good team game for mixed abilities - 3 or 4 players each take a tee shot, the best of the drives is chosen, all team members then place and hit their own ball from that spot, repeating the process until the ball is holed. The team with the least number of shots over 18 holes wins.
